不同种类硫化体系对NBR/ACM共混胶性能的影响 被引量:1

Effect of different vulcanization systems on properties of NBR/ACM blended rubber

摘要 在NBR/ACM共混胶中固定ACM相硫化体系,以NBR相硫化体系为变量,研究了不同种类硫化体系对NBR/ACM共混胶性能的影响。研究表明普通硫磺硫化体系与过氧化物硫化体系硫化程度高,硫载体硫化体系硫化程度较低;硫磺过氧化物并用硫化体系常规物理机械性能总体较好;有效硫磺硫化体系与过氧化物硫化体系耐热空气老化性能较好;过氧化物硫化体系耐油性能最佳。 This paper investigated the effect of different vulcanization systems on the properties of NBR/ACM blended rubber by fxing ACM phase vulcanization system in NBR/ACM blended rubber and making NBR phase vulcanization system as a variable. The research shows that the ordinary sulfur vulcanization system and the peroxide vulcanization system have a high degree of vulcanization, and the sulfur carrier vulcanization system has a low degree of vulcanization. The conventional physical and mechanical properties of the sulfur peroxide combined vulcanization system are generally better. The effective sulfur vulcanization system and the peroxide vulcanization system have better heat-resistant air aging properties. The peroxide vulcanization system has the best oil resistance.
